There is a huge gap in the top between the blind and window frame of around 2.5cm is this normal or do i need to have a pelmet made? asked on Sep 03, 2016 Hi Kim, Thank you for contacting us and assuming that your roller blind is fitted in the recess/reveal of your window, when the roller fabric is rolled up, the bracket has to have enough space to cater to the increased diameter of the fabric on the roller's tube. This however changes when the roller blind gets lowered and its overall diameter gets reduced, thus leaving a gap of approx. 20mm. This is considered normal and should you wish to reduce the amount of light bleed that comes through over the top of the roller tube when lowered and yes, you can consider fitting a pelmet to further control the amount of light bleed.
